                  It's not surprising. Walmart has been doing this a lot lately. They have been putting the instawatch stickers on every blu-ray they throw into the bin or else putting it on discs that are scheduled to be instawatch at some point. I myself just bought the Statham triple pack which had the sticker but isn't instawatch. Remember, as you can see in the D2D threads most Walmart employees have no idea that Walmart is even associated with Vudu or that you can watch your movies online. So it's not surprising that things get labeled incorrectly.

                  So you can do two things. Either look up the product on the instawatch eligible page (which is convoluted at best) or hope that it eventually does become instawatch. Keep your receipts because if the movie does at a later date become instawatch eligible then rescanning the receipt will add the movie to your account.
